Output 3cab57df1e6b1b54a55c1f076da1605333349d8fa447d0d5f21d69e4be723586:21

value
85004
script pubkey
OP_0 OP_PUSHBYTES_20 ccf0c1f2caadc74ed2a18e18330ebadb1c27e7cb
address
bc1qencvruk24hr5a54p3cvrxr46mvwz0e7thnmees
transaction
3cab57df1e6b1b54a55c1f076da1605333349d8fa447d0d5f21d69e4be723586
confirmations
58365
spent
true